American Samoa’s first match outside of Oceania has ended in a 5-2 defeat to the US Virgin Islands in a FIFA Series fixture at the Juan Ramón Loubriel Stadium in Bayamón, Puerto Rico.
With new head coach Diego Gomez leading the nation for the first time, American Samoa did at least score their first international goal against a nation outside of OFC, but it proved in vain after leaking goals in a poor beginning to the contest.
American Samoa were caught cold at the start, conceding three goals inside the first 20 minutes as US Virgin Islands eased into an early unassailable lead.
It took just seven minutes for Joshua Ramos to open the scoring for the Caribbean nation, turning home a low cross from Jett Blaschka into the back of the net.
Making his senior international debut, Toryn Penders added a bright spark for the US Virgin Islands down the right wing throughout. He scored twice in 120 seconds to virtually seal the outcome of the match inside the first twenty minutes, twice beating American Samoa’s own debutant goalkeeper Kai Yandall.
Captain Jannick Liburd resumed the scoring with the US Virgin Islands’ fourth goal in the 53rd minute – also his first at senior international level.
American Samoa weren’t to go down without a fight though, adding some respect to the scoreline with two late goals.
Captain Ali’i Mitchell scored both – first winning a penalty that saw opposing defender Brad Robinson sent off with a red card. Mitchell duly sent the keeper the wrong way from the spot, before stealing possession back moments after the restart and adding a second with a sublime finish on his left foot into the bottom-left corner.
The US Virgin Islands rallied, winning a penalty of their own in second half stoppage-time and added a fifth goal through Jimson St. Louis to hold on for their first victory in an official FIFA-recognised match since 2022.
Whilst it isn’t the result Gomez and his American Samoa side wanted; they improved as the match progressed and will face either Guam or Puerto Rico in their second FIFA Series match on Saturday local time.
US Virgin Islands: 5 (Joshua RAMOS 7’, Toryn PENDERS 19’, 20’, Jannick LIBURD 53’, Jimson ST. LOUIS (P) 90+3’)
American Samoa: 2 (Ali’i MITCHELL 80’, 82’)
HT: 3-0
